| contents | We introduce and analyse a mathematical model describing the dynamics of particles generated by charge-exchange interactions. The model extends the well-established exchange-driven growth model, previously studied in several works, by allowing for particle densities defined on the entire integer lattice. Despite the many similarities between the two models, substantial differences arise both in their qualitative behaviour and in their mathematical analysis. Under suitable assumptions on the kernel in the collision operator, we establish global well-posedness in the class of nonnegative densities with finite first moment. Moreover, under a detailed balance condition, we investigate the structure of equilibria and analyse their stability by means of entropy methods. |
